RECREATIONAL ACTIVITIES OFFICER

The Organisation

The United Protestant Association of NSW Limited ("UPA") is a values-driven non-profit care organisation serving local communities throughout NSW, with a vision of always ensuring we have "our people by our side". With a staff compliment of 1400 and a turnover in excess of $100M, UPA is a non-profit Company limited by guarantee.

Our services include: -
* Residential Aged Care
* Home Care Services
* Retirement Villages
The Opportunity

We are looking for a Recreational Activities Officer to join our team at Murray Vale in our Riverina Murray Region. We have a permanent part-time opportunity available that includes being available for weekend work. You will make a difference to our residents by facilitating positive health and wellbeing options for individuals, their families, and carers.

As the Recreational Activities Officer, you will drive the energy, engagement, and participation of residents into a range of social, recreational, and cultural activities. You will also lead mental health and wellbeing programs which empower our resident's choices and independence.

In fulfilling the role, it is essential that you have:
* The ability to plan, organise, and lead activities for our residents that will meet social and recreational needs while also promoting independence and increasing quality of life.
* The ability to assess and document the effectiveness of the programs, by tracking residents' progress and changing the programs as needed
* Minimum of a Certificate IV in Leisure and Lifestyle
* Senior First Aid Certificate (desirable)
* Previous experience within an aged care setting
* Highly developed organisation and time management skills
* The ability to solve problems independently
*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
* An understanding of Resident Rights, Aged Care Accreditation Standards and Outcomes
* Computer skills in Microsoft Word, Outlook, Excel, Power Point, internet/intranet skills, email communication, and confidence with smart phones and digital devices
* Knowledge of Work Health and Safety
